Home > Error Log > Apache Error Log Linux

Apache Error Log Linux


Custom Error Log To find out the custom location of Apache error log, open /etc/httpd/conf/httpd.conf with a text editor, and look for ServerRoot, which shows the top of the Apache server got it. A simple visual puzzle to die for I accepted a counter offer and regret it: can I go back and contact the previous company? The location and content of the access log are controlled by the CustomLog directive. his comment is here

Logs are typically under /var/log, but some systems have them elsewhere. –Gilles May 19 '12 at 12:51 add a comment| 3 Answers 3 active oldest votes up vote 91 down vote find / -iname name_of_error_log_file_that_apachectl_spit_out You might have to do a find / -iname apachectl or various permutations thereof to find where the binary is. For example, the format string "%m %U%q %H" will log the method, path, query-string, and protocol, resulting in exactly the same output as "%r". 200 (%>s) This is the status code Your best bet is to run that command and look for the error_log using find. http://unix.stackexchange.com/questions/38978/where-are-apache-file-access-logs-stored

Apache Error Log Ubuntu

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the In addition, it can often create problems with insufficient file descriptors. This is the identifying information that the client browser reports about itself. The LogFormat directive can be used to simplify the selection of the contents of the logs.

In reality, ErrorLog may point to any arbitrary location on your Linux system. If no content was returned to the client, this value will be "-". Literal characters may also be placed in the format string and will be copied directly into the log output. Linux Service Log Depending on how the server was compiled the --prefix flag might have been pointed somewhere else.

Since it is possible to customize the access log, you can obtain more information about error conditions using that log file. it was a bit different on windows. –Stann Nov 24 '10 at 19:38 add a comment| up vote 34 down vote Check these settings in php.ini: error_reporting = E_ALL | E_STRICT The logs are not always in /var/log/apache/* or /var/log/httpd Sometimes they are in /var/log/httpd/, sometimes people compile Apache from source and the apache variable DEFAULT_ERRORLOG gets set differently so error log https://httpd.apache.org/docs/1.3/logs.html The third entry gives the IP address of the client that generated the error.

asked 4 years ago viewed 299143 times active 6 months ago Linked 7 How do I find where Apache keeps the log files? Linux Apache Error Log Location For more information about how to do this, please see this article. This section describes how to configure the server to record information in the access log. You can change the ownership of the folder to root:apache and also add yourself to the apache group.

Php Error Log Linux

On unix systems, you can accomplish this using: tail -f error_log Access Log Related Modules mod_log_config Related Directives CustomLog LogFormat SetEnvIf The server access log records all requests processed by the Bonuses This is a symlink to /var/log/httpd/error_log with freshly installed Apache. Apache Error Log Ubuntu Shared hosting accounts cannot view the raw Apache log files for the entire server. Mysql Error Log Linux Probably you never started apache and therefore this directory did not get created.

Is it unethical to get paid for the work and time invested in thesis? this content The first post is not going to work in all cases. Apache Error Log Location on CentOS, Fedora or RHEL Default Error Log On Red Hat based Linux, a system-wide Apache error log file is by default placed in /var/log/httpd/error_log. Delete files or directories from a tar or zip file Weird characters like â are showing up on my site « Delete files or directories from a tar or zip file Where Is Apache Log

For a complete list of the possible contents of the format string, see the mod_log_config documentation. The error log is usually written to a file (typically error_log on unix systems and error.log on Windows and OS/2). During testing, it is often useful to continuously monitor the error log for any problems. http://dis-lb.net/error-log/apache-2-error-log.php It is not possible to customize the error log by adding or removing information.

How to indicate you are going straight? How To Check Apache Error Logs In Linux Semi-managed dedicated servers and VPS If you have a semi-managed Flex Dedicated Server or VPS, you have root access. Looking for "turn to dust" alternative as a single word Which requires more energy: walking 1 km or cycling 1 km at the same speed?

apache-http-server centos logging share|improve this question edited Nov 28 '12 at 13:07 asked Nov 28 '12 at 11:40 Krystian 127117 add a comment| 1 Answer 1 active oldest votes up vote

To find out where the logs are, according to how Apache says it was instructed to generate logs you will want to run the following command: /usr/sbin/apachectl -V some distributions of Location of error log is set using ErrorLog directive. This default location can be customized by editing Apache configuration file. Linux Apache Access Logs Subtraction with negative result How can I obtain 12v dc, 3.3v dc and 5v dc from a single 5v Li-ion battery?

Translate in-line equations to TeX code (Any Package?) Train carriages in the Czech Republic Why are some programming languages turing complete but lack some abilities of other languages? The first contains the basic CLF information, while the second and third contain referer and browser information. Apache will start the piped-log process when the server starts, and will restart it if it crashes while the server is running. (This last feature is why we can refer to check over here L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-agent}i\"" combined
CustomLog log/acces_log combined This format is exactly the same as the Common Log Format, with the addition of two

Louise has helped start and run several interactive sites for sports organizations and businesses. This gives the site that the client reports having been referred from. (This should be the page that links to or includes /apache_pb.gif). "Mozilla/4.08 [en] (Win98; I ;Nav)" (\"%{User-agent}i\") The User-Agent LogFormat "%h %l %u %t \"%r\" %>s %b" common
CustomLog logs/access_log common This defines the nickname common and associates it with a particular log format string. Can I change owner to my user?

Can Customs make me go back to return my electronic equipment or is it a scam? The CustomLog directive now subsumes the functionality of all the older directives. Script Log In order to aid in debugging, the ScriptLog directive allows you to record the input to and output from CGI scripts. More information is available in the mod_cgi documentation.

However, you can still view log file information for your own account. In order to write logs to a pipe, simply replace the filename with the pipe character "|", followed by the name of the executable which should accept log entries on its Why did companions have such high social standing? Sometimes people configure different vhosts to store logs in different places because they have a bunch of domains and they do not want all of the other customers on the box

For example: ServerRoot "/etc/httpd" Now look for a line that starts with ErrorLog, which indicates where Apache web server is writing its error logs. Convince people not to share their password with trusted others What is the difference between touch file and > file? Support Xmodulo Did you find this tutorial helpful?